Output feca4acc4eea8dd1b5e8fdbe3600d21cdbe8f6dbbbb73aadacfcf8d8ae498e1e:2

value
129815660
script pubkey
OP_0 OP_PUSHBYTES_20 60aab43bc389fd73f9b51fc51f49dfb6f32eb48f
address
bc1qvz4tgw7r387h87d4rlz37jwlkmejady0358dup
transaction
feca4acc4eea8dd1b5e8fdbe3600d21cdbe8f6dbbbb73aadacfcf8d8ae498e1e
confirmations
302389
spent
true